The Benefits Of Legally Privileged Employee Relations Outsourcing

In today’s fast-paced business world, companies are constantly looking for ways to streamline their processes and cut costs. One of the ways many organizations are doing this is by outsourcing their employee relations functions. This involves partnering with an external firm that specializes in handling employee relations issues such as grievances, disputes, disciplinary actions, and compliance matters.

But not all employee relations outsourcing is created equal. One key factor that companies should consider when outsourcing these functions is whether they can benefit from legally privileged employee relations outsourcing. This specialized form of outsourcing provides a higher level of protection and confidentiality for sensitive employee relations matters, making it a valuable option for many organizations.

So what exactly is legally privileged employee relations outsourcing, and how can it benefit your organization? Let’s take a closer look.

legally privileged employee relations outsourcing involves partnering with a firm that employs attorneys to handle your organization’s employee relations matters. This means that all communications and work performed by the firm are protected by attorney-client privilege, providing a higher level of confidentiality and protection for your organization.

When you choose legally privileged employee relations outsourcing, you can rest assured that sensitive information will not be disclosed to third parties. This can be particularly important when dealing with issues that could potentially lead to legal action, such as discrimination complaints or wrongful termination claims. By working with a firm that offers legally privileged employee relations outsourcing, you can minimize the risk of litigation and protect your organization from costly legal disputes.

In addition to enhanced confidentiality, legally privileged employee relations outsourcing can also provide your organization with access to expert legal guidance. The attorneys employed by the outsourcing firm can provide valuable advice and recommendations on how to handle employee relations issues in compliance with relevant labor laws and regulations. This can help your organization avoid potential legal pitfalls and ensure that your employee relations practices are in line with best practices.
